Welcome to Paradox- Anya

    In Ookami's time, Big Brother was pissed. A thin trail of smoke trailed from his thin scarred lips. Ookami had failed them. In actuality he was rather surprised as Ookami had struck them as a resourceful young operative, but there were other operatives waiting to be inducted and assigned.
   
Bending his head slightly forward, he opened Ookami's paper profile, slicing his finger along the edge. Swearing, he scowled; with all the technology available, they still used paper for their people.  It was safer, he agreed, digital technology  opened up to many security risks. He blotted the cut with a tissue before grabbing a large red stamper and slamming it against Ookami's black and white photo, leaving the dark red letters imprinted M E, mental execution.
  
 Throwing it on top of the other paper files that lined the corner of his desk. Grabbing another, he glanced for a second at the ticking clocks that clicked and ticked softly and in tune against the far gray wall.
  
  Anya knocked softly on Big Brother's door before entering. She never directly looked in to Big Brother's face, but she offered him the same soft reassuring smile as she gathered all the M E files into her hands. 
   
 "Anya, look at me" Big Brother growled softly. That auburn hair and light violet eyes made his heart tingle. He wanted her, even knowing what she did, that the last thing those M E saw was her smiling face. He wished lustfully to take her and run his fingers through the thick, wavy umber hair. But, he restrained himself to just fantasizing and making sure at least one M E rested on the corner of his desk each day. 
   
  Anya looked up and met his eyes for a brief second "yes?" she replied softly. He felt that rush, but merely replied in a even tone, " that is all the files for today, thank you"
   
  She held the files under her arm, her heels clicking against the tile floor. Overhead the lights gave off their eeiry humming, dimming softer and softer as she turned down the hall that led to her department.  She entered her office and the drabness of the building disappeared. Her entire office was brightened by flowers and plants, some real, some artificial, but all crammed and overflowing onto the surfaces of the room.   
  
  Sitting down at her simple wooden desk, she began typing up the warrants of seizure for every person in the stack. These would be handed out to the correct officials, who would execute the orders. She recognized Ookami as she opened his file and sighed, he had seemed like an interesting operative, but apparently not good enough. She really did not feel anything, glancing over each photo as she ran through them, this was her job and she was good at it. She gave each M E a minute of care, before they permanently disappeared.
